css預處理器

2021-08-04 09:53:37 字數 611 閱讀 3959

css預處理定義了一種新的語言,其思想是一種專門的程式語言,為css增加了一些程式設計的特性。將css作為目標生成檔案。開發者可以使用這種語言進行編碼工作。

css預處理器是一種專門的程式語言,進行web頁面樣式設計,然後再編譯成正常的css檔案,以供專案使用。css預處理器為css增加了一些程式設計特性,無需考慮瀏覽器的相容性問題。可在css中使用遍歷,簡單的邏輯程式,函式等程式語言中的一些基本特性。可以讓css更加簡潔。適應性更強,可讀性增加,更易於**維護等諸多好處。

通過css預處理技術可以很好的提公升css的程式設計性,提高css**的開發效率和可維護性。

預處理器工具:

sass

,less

,styles

,compass

比較熱門

我常使用less,相比較sass,less要簡單容易上手一些,但程式設計性叫sass而言,略有不足,但不妨礙它廣泛使用。因為less本身的語法就已經夠用了、

a、less注釋:/**/ ,//

b、變數     @width:300px

c、混合,將定義好的classa輕鬆引入到另乙個classb中,從而實現classb繼承classa 的所有屬性

d、模式匹配,運算,巢狀(後續補充)

CSS預處理器

什麼是css預處器?css 預處理器用一種專門的程式語言,進行 web 頁面樣式設計,然後再編譯成正常的 css 檔案,以供專案使用。css 預處理器為 css 增加一些程式設計的特性,無需考慮瀏覽器的相容性問題 sass sass 是採用 ruby 語言編寫的一款 css 預處理語言,它誕生於20...

css預處理器

sass less是什麼?大家為什麼要使用他們?他們是css預處理器。他是css上的一種抽象層。他們是一種特殊的語法 語言編譯成css。less是一種動態樣式語言.將css賦予了動態語言的特性,如變數,繼承,運算,函式.less 既可以在客戶端上執行 支援ie 6 webkit,firefox 也可...

CSS(預處理器)

less是一種動態樣式語言,屬於css預處理器的範疇,它擴充套件了 css 語言,增加了變數 mixin 函式等特性,使 css 更易維護和擴充套件。less 既可以在客戶端上執行 也可以借助node.js在服務端執行。less的中文官網 bootstrap中less教程 以 開頭的注釋,不會被編譯...